ICSI Conducts Career Awareness Program in Mumbai

The Western India Regional Council of the Institute of Company Secretaries of India conducted a Career Awareness Program at V. K. Krishna Menon College of Commerce and Economics in Bhandup, Mumbai on July 15, 2026.

The event was led by CS Yogesh Choudhary, Chairman of ICSI-WIRC, as part of the nationwide Career Awareness Week celebrations. Officials from ICSI-WIRC provided valuable information about the company secretary profession, including its scope, career opportunities, and the steps to become a qualified professional.

During the program, students were guided on the essential skills required to succeed in the corporate sector. The session was highly interactive and informative, offering clarity and direction to students interested in pursuing careers in corporate governance and related fields.

Around 339 students actively participated in the program, which was organized to provide career guidance and support holistic professional development. The college expressed appreciation for ICSI's commitment to guiding students and helping them make informed decisions about their careers.

The Institute of Company Secretaries of India is a professional body that aims to promote and regulate the company secretary profession in India. The Western India Regional Council is one of the five regional councils of ICSI, responsible for promoting the profession and providing support to students and professionals in the western region.
